I've noticed my mimic tang flicking across rocks and the substrate the last few days. First time I've seen any of my fish try to scratch themselves on the rocks (though I occasionally see my blenny use her tail to scratch her body). I've looked very closely at my tang and do not see any sort of white spots on her fins or body that would suggest an ich outbreak - in fact I've never seen white spots on any of my fish even though I am sure there is ich in my tank. My tang also has not really filled out much weight-wise - she was pretty skinny when she arrived and I can always see her very full tummy after she eats, but it doesn't look like she's really put any meat on her bones. Now with this flicking behavior, and the crash of my tiny tank, I'm starting to get concerned about her. Is there anything that could be going on other than ich since I don't see any white spots? I've been feeding every other day and nori sheets about 3x per week - should I up feeding at all? There is little aggression in my tank and water quality is adequate, though I recently changed foods and have noticed a diatom outbreak so might have some phosphates in my system from the new food (its a food my LFS makes that has similar ingredients to Rods and they gave me a free bag to try - I'm not really sure I like it though because I think the pieces are too small for most of my fish to really feast on once its thawed). Anyhow, any ideas as to what to do at this point? (And no need to link me to the stickies about ich and treatment - I know them!)
